The travel time between Wakefield Stations and Aspley Guise by train varies depending on the type of train and the route, but the average journey time is 5hrs 1 mins & the fastest journey takes 3hrs 50 mins.
The fastest journey time by train from Wakefield Stations to Aspley Guise is 3hrs 50 mins.
Train ticket prices from Wakefield Stations to Aspley Guise can start from as little as £48.50 when you book in advance. The cost of tickets can vary depending on the time of day, route and class you book and are usually more expensive if you book on the day.
The departure and arrival times for trains between Wakefield Stations and Aspley Guise vary depending on the day of the week and the type of train. Generally, there are around 23 departures and arrivals throughout the day. The first departure is 05:18, and the last train of the day leaves at 23:27.

No, unfortunately there are no direct trains between Wakefield Stations & Aspley Guise. However, there are 23 possible journeys which require a change.
CrossCountry, West Midlands Trains, Thameslink, East Midlands Railway, Avanti West Coast, Northern Rail and London North Eastern Railway are the main train operating companies running services between Wakefield Stations and Aspley Guise.

Aspley Guise Station offers a minimalist set of amenities focusing on accessibility and essential support rather than facilities mirroring a temple of bustling commercial activity. There is no ticket office or ticket machines, so ensure you purchase your tickets online beforehand or make use of available mobile ticketing options. However, thoughtfully, there is an induction loop installed to assist those with hearing impairments.
Step-free access is present throughout, albeit with limitations to platform 1, which cannot accommodate ramps. Platform 2 provides ramp access, aiding those traveling toward Bedford from Bletchley. Assistance is available, but it requires prior arrangement with the Passenger Assist Team to schedule a smooth transition. Customer help points are available, offering guidance and information as needed. For more assistance with your journey, check out the Passenger Assist details.
Aspley Guise is well-integrated with the surrounding transport network, offering rail replacement services that operate efficiently from designated areas near the station. Those heading to Bletchley will find their services commencing from the entrance to the Bletchley-bound platform, while those destined for Bedford will board from the village side of the level crossing.
